Web9 jul. 2024 · The level of WBCs in your blood remains fairly stable, but your counts may go up or down, depending on what is going on in your body. For example, bacterial infections tend to cause a rise in neutrophils, allergies cause a rise in eosinophils, and viral infections cause a rise in lymphocytes. Web14 jan. 2024 · A complete blood count (CBC) is a blood test. It's used to look at overall health and find a wide range of conditions, including anemia, infection and leukemia. A complete blood count test measures the following: Red blood cells, which carry oxygen. White blood cells, which fight infection. Hemoglobin, the oxygen-carrying protein in red …
